Original Description
Christian Rohlfs' Sonnenblume (Sunflower) radiates with the vibrant energy of German Expressionism, a style the artist helped pioneer in the early 20th century. Painted in 1921, the work bursts with bold, emotive brushstrokes and a heightened color palette—vivid yellows and deep blues clashing yet harmonizing to capture the sunflower’s raw vitality. Rohlfs, initially influenced by Impressionism, later embraced the emotional intensity of Expressionism, and this shift is evident here. Unlike Van Gogh’s sunflowers, which exude a turbulent beauty, Rohlfs’ interpretation feels more primal, almost mystical. The painting’s significance lies in its defiance of naturalism, instead prioritizing emotional resonance—a hallmark of Expressionism’s rebellion against traditional aesthetics. Though less famous than his contemporaries like Kirchner or Nolde, Rohlfs’ Sonnenblume remains a compelling example of how Expressionism infused everyday subjects with profound emotional depth.
